Incinerators are a type of waste management system that have been used for centuries to dispose of various types of waste materials. These high-temperature devices are designed to burn solid waste and reduce it to ash, making them an effective way to manage waste in a safe and efficient manner. 1. Liquid Injection Waste Incinerators
Liquid injection waste incinerators are designed to burn liquid waste materials such as oils, solvents, and other hazardous liquids. These incinerators are equipped with special nozzles that inject the liquid waste directly into the combustion chamber, where it is burned at high temperatures. Liquid injection waste incinerators are often used in industrial settings where liquid waste is produced as a byproduct of manufacturing processes.
2. Rotary Kiln Incinerators
Rotary kiln incinerators are large, cylindrical machines that are used to burn solid waste materials. The waste is fed into the rotating kiln, where it is exposed to high temperatures that break down the organic and inorganic components of the waste. Rotary kiln incinerators are often used to dispose of municipal solid waste, medical waste, and other types of solid waste that cannot be easily burned in other types of incinerators.
3. Controlled Air Incinerators
Controlled air incinerators are designed to burn waste materials in a controlled environment to minimize air pollution and emissions. These incinerators have special air control systems that regulate the amount of oxygen that is fed into the combustion chamber, ensuring that the waste is burned efficiently and cleanly. Controlled air incinerators are often used in facilities that are required to meet strict environmental regulations.
4. Moving Grate Incinerators
Moving grate incinerators are designed to burn solid waste materials on a moving grate system that slowly moves the waste through the combustion chamber. The waste is burned at high temperatures as it moves along the grate, ensuring that all parts of the waste are thoroughly combusted. Moving grate incinerators are commonly used to dispose of municipal solid waste and industrial waste materials.
5. Fluidized Bed Incinerators
Fluidized bed incinerators are a type of incinerator that uses a bed of sand or other inert material to suspend the waste materials in a fluidized state. The waste is burned at high temperatures as it is suspended in the fluidized bed, ensuring that it is completely burned and converted into ash. Fluidized bed incinerators are often used to dispose of hazardous waste materials that are difficult to burn in other types of incinerators.
6. Multiple Hearth Incinerators
Multiple hearth incinerators are a type of incinerator that consists of multiple stacked hearths or chambers that are used to burn waste materials. The waste is fed into the top hearth, where it is burned at high temperatures and then moved to the next hearth for further combustion. Multiple hearth incinerators are commonly used to dispose of sewage sludge, wastewater treatment plant sludge, and other types of organic waste materials.
